Funksjonen krsort
Funksjonen krsort sorterer en array
i synkende rekkefølge etter nøkler.
Funksjonen endrer selve arrayen.
Syntaks
krsort(array &$array, int $flags = SORT_REGULAR): bool
Eksempel
La oss sortere en array i synkende rekkefølge etter nøkler:
<?php
$arr = [
'b' => 1,
'e' => 3,
'c' => 2,
'a' => 5,
'd' => 4,
];
krsort($arr);
var_dump($arr);
?>
Resultat av kjøring av koden:
[
'd' => 4,
'e' => 3,
'c' => 2,
'b' => 1,
'a' => 5,
]
Se også
-
funksjonen
sort,
som sorterer i stigende rekkefølge etter elementer -
funksjonen
rsort,
som sorterer i synkende rekkefølge etter elementer -
funksjonen
ksort,
som sorterer i stigende rekkefølge etter nøkler -
funksjonen
asort,
som sorterer i stigende rekkefølge etter elementer med bevaring av nøkler -
funksjonen
arsort,
som sorterer i synkende rekkefølge etter elementer med bevaring av nøkler -
funksjonen
natsort,
som sorterer på naturlig måte -
funksjonen
natcasesort,
som sorterer på naturlig måte uten hensyn til store/små bokstaver -
funksjonen
usort,
som sorterer ved hjelp av en callback-funksjon -
funksjonen
uksort,
som sorterer ved hjelp av en callback-funksjon etter nøkler -
funksjonen
uasort,
som sorterer ved hjelp av en callback-funksjon med bevaring av nøkler -
funksjonen
array_multisort,
som sorterer flere arrays